Circuit Breaker Timer for Precise Timing Tests

A circuit breaker timer is a device or control function that automatically operates a circuit breaker after a preset time delay. It is used to protect electrical equipment from faults such as overloads, short circuits, or abnormal conditions. When a fault occurs, the timer allows the breaker to remain closed for a specified period before tripping. This helps prevent unnecessary interruptions and provides coordination between protective devices. Circuit breaker timers are commonly used in power systems, industrial electrical installations, and testing equipment to ensure safe and reliable operation.
